Course Details
• Fundamentals of Nutrition: Understanding the basics of macronutrients, micronutrients, and their roles in the human body.
• Nutrition for Athletic Performance: Examining the impact of nutrition on physical performance, with a focus on optimizing energy intake and preventing sports-related nutritional deficiencies.
• Hydration for Peak Performance: Exploring the importance of hydration in athletic performance, including recommended fluid intake guidelines and the risks of dehydration and overhydration.
• Nutrient Timing and Supplementation: Investigating the impact of nutrient timing and supplementation on athletic performance, including the benefits and drawbacks of popular supplements.
• Dietary Patterns for Optimal Health: Examining the relationship between dietary patterns and health outcomes, with a focus on plant-based diets and their impact on athletic performance.
• Nutrition for Injury Prevention and Recovery: Exploring the role of nutrition in injury prevention and recovery, including the use of anti-inflammatory diets and nutritional strategies for promoting tissue repair and reducing inflammation.
• Nutrition for Special Populations: Examining the unique nutritional needs of special populations, including adolescent athletes, women, and older adults.
• Behavior Change and Nutrition Education: Investigating the role of behavior change and nutrition education in promoting healthy dietary patterns and athletic performance.
